About Institute of Singapore Chartered Accountants (ISCA)

ISCA administers the Singapore Chartered Accountant Qualification and confers the CA (Singapore) designation. The organization serves chartered accountants in Singapore and across 40+ countries, with a membership base embedded in financial reporting, audit, advisory, and forensics. ISCA is part of Chartered Accountants Worldwide, a federation spanning 190 countries and 1.8 million members and students. The institute operates as a nonprofit with 51–200 employees, balancing regulatory and standard-setting functions with member services, professional development, and partnership ecosystem growth.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is ISCA's main role in Singapore?

ISCA is the national accountancy body of Singapore, responsible for administering the Singapore Chartered Accountant Qualification and conferring the CA (Singapore) credential. It advocates for the accountancy profession and sets standards across audit, financial reporting, and advisory.

How many ISCA members are there globally?

ISCA has over 40,000 members based in Singapore and across 40+ countries. Members are supported through 12 overseas chapters in 10 countries and are part of Chartered Accountants Worldwide, a network of 1.8 million chartered accountants and students globally.
